A bicycle and rider of mass 120 kg are travelling at a speed of 15 km/hr on a level road. The rider applies brake to the rear wheel which is 0.9 m diameter. How far the bicycle will travel before it comes to rest ? The pressure applied to the brake is 100 N and u = 0.05. Assume that no other resistance is acting on bicycle. Also find number of revolutions made by bicycle before coming to rest.
